Hegstrand died because of a heart attack

The Road Warriors, a professional wrestling tag team, were first who introduced bodybuilding-type muscularity in this sport. This tag team was composed of Hawk (Mike Hegstrand) and Animal (Joe Laurinaitis). Hegstrand died in 2003. His death was sudden because of a heart attack. This wrestler died at the age of 46. As it is known, popular media usually reports about deaths of professional wrestlers, linking the cases with use of anabolic steroids. The death of Hegstrand was not an exception. After the death of this professional wrestler a lot of articles appeared in newspapers that demonized anabolic steroids for this case.
Joe Laurinaitis admitted to intake of steroids by this professional wrestling team. But he pointed out that these medicines hadn’t lead to Hegstrand’s death. He added that other conditions were responsible for Hegstrand’s death as well as deaths of other wrestlers. Joe Laurinaitis noted that such drugs, as cocaine and Xanax had to be blamed for such cases. Laurinaitis confirmed that he wanted to explain that steroids had not been linked with death of Hegstrand.
Joe Laurinaitis claimed that cocaine and Xanax had caused the death of this wrestler. He also announced that these drugs led to deaths of such people, as Henning, Rick Rude and Davey Boy Smith. According to Laurinaitis, usage of cocaine often leads to administration of morphine. These drugs destruct health wholly and lead to heart attacks.
